| Definitions from the WebCrown WitnessDescription:A crown witness refers to an individual who provides firsthand evidence or testimony in a criminal trial on behalf of the prosecution. This person is typically a crucial witness, as their testimony can heavily influence the outcome of the case. Sample Sentences:
